How they compare

France currently reports 0.9082 against 0.0493 in Low-Income and Developing Countries, a difference of 0.8589.

That makes France's figure about 18.4 times Low-Income and Developing Countries's.

Across all 41 years both countries report, France has been ahead every year.

France ranks 10th and Low-Income and Developing Countries ranks 9th of 183 countries.

France has averaged higher in every one of the 5 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ade France Low-Income and Developing Countries Difference Ahead
1980s 0.0789 0.0246 0.0543 France
1990s 0.2949 0.0307 0.2642 France
2000s 0.8447 0.0336 0.8111 France
2010s 0.8732 0.0442 0.8289 France
2020s 0.9082 0.0493 0.859 France

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The dataset contains nine indices that summarize how developed financial institutions and financial markets are in terms of their depth, access, and efficiency. These indices are aggregated into an overall index of financial development. With the coverage of over 180 countries on annual frequency from 1980 onwards, the database should offer a useful analytical tool for researchers and policy makers.
